1.1 什么是SolrCloud SolrCloud(solr 雲)是Solr提供的分布式搜索方案,當你需要大規模,容錯,分布式索引和檢索能力時使用 SolrCloud。當一個系統的索引數據量少的時候是不需要使用SolrCloud的,當索引量很大,搜索請求並發很高,這時需要使用SolrCloud ...
概述 Solr單機支持的搜索數據量是有一定上限的,這個取決於搜索的復雜程度,服務器的硬件配置與業務的要求等等,所以將搜索功能分布化將是對於大數據搜索的一個必然趨勢。 Solr從 . 版本開始,自帶了分布式搜索 Distributed Search 。這個功能使得Solr能夠通過多服務器進行橫行擴展,對數據進行水平拆分,從而支持海量數據的搜索功能。 Solr . . 版本對分布式搜索的支持功能如下: ...
2012-10-10 15:17 4 8816 推薦指數:
1.1 什么是SolrCloud SolrCloud(solr 雲)是Solr提供的分布式搜索方案,當你需要大規模,容錯,分布式索引和檢索能力時使用 SolrCloud。當一個系統的索引數據量少的時候是不需要使用SolrCloud的,當索引量很大,搜索請求並發很高,這時需要使用SolrCloud ...
Solrcloud介紹: SolrCloud(solr集群)是Solr提供的分布式搜索方案。 當你需要大規模,容錯,分布式索引和檢索能力時使用SolrCloud。 當索引量很大,搜索請求並發很高時,同樣需要使用SolrCloud來滿足這些需求。 不過當一個系統的索引數據量少 ...
3篇關於分布式鎖的文章,可以結合看: consul實現分布式鎖:https://www.cnblogs.com/jiujuan/p/10527786.html redis實現分布式鎖:https://www.cnblogs.com/jiujuan/p/10595838.html etcd實現 ...
1 1. Solr 1.1 Features 1.2 Pros & Cons 1.3 References 2 2. Senseidb 2.1 Features 2.2 Pros & ...
ES整個查詢過程是scatter/gather的過程,具體如下: 圖見 https://blog.csdn.net/thomas0yang/article/details/78572596?utm_ ...
在分布式服務框架中,一個最基礎的問題就是遠程服務是怎么通訊的,在Java領域中有很多可實現遠程通訊的技術,例如:RMI、MINA、ESB、Burlap、Hessian、SOAP、EJB和JMS等,這些名詞之間到底是些什么關系呢,它們背后到底是基於什么原理實現的呢,了解這些是實現分布式服務框架 ...
前言 通過前面章節的了解,我們已經知道 Elasticsearch 是一個實時的分布式搜索分析引擎,它能讓你以一個之前從未有過的速度和規模,去探索你的數據。它被用作全文檢索、結構化搜索、分析以及這三個功能的組合。 Elasticsearch 可以橫向擴展至數百(甚至數千)的服務器節點 ...
目錄 背景 1、單機架構 2、應用服務與數據服務分離 3、應用服務器集群架構 3.1 應用服務器集群架構下的Session管理 4、數據庫讀寫分離 5、利用緩存技術進行加速 6、分布式數據庫系統與分布式文件系統 ...